The solution below uses the information given in the original problem: … WebCalculate the partial pressure of neon gas in the mixture. Solution: 1) Determine total moles of gas: 2.50 + 0.38 + 1.34 = 4.22 moles 2) Use PV = nRT: (x) (19.5 atm) = (4.22 mol) (0.08206) (288 K) x = 5.115 atm Determine the partial pressure for neon: 5.115 x (1.34/4.22) = 1.62 atm Note: (1.34/4.22) determines the mole fraction of neon.
